N/A America`s ultimate jam-band phenomenon, Phish became a national institution, and the heirs apparent to the Grateful Dead during a career that spanned 21 years, and ended with their breakup in August 2004. IT was a weekend-long festival that took place in the summer of 2003, in Limestone, Maine, featuring multiple daily Phish sets as well as performances and art by many other talented artists. Originally aired on PBS, this is an important document of a legendary band at a crucial moment. The songs include What is It? 46 Days, Sunk City, David Bowie, Ghost Jam, Chalk Dust Torture, You Enjoy Myself, Antelope, and others, plus bonus material not included in the original broadcast.
